Nguyen Thi Phuong is supported
Recently, the Vietnam women's volleyball team has finalized the list of players registered for the second phase of the 2025 SEA V.League. Accordingly, the main striker Nguyen Thi Phuong returned to the squad to replace libero Ninh Anh.
This is a face expected to play explosively with his teammates when the next round takes place at home. At the same time, fans also gave words of encouragement and motivation to the female athlete born in 1999.

The Vietnam women's team has returned home
At around 6:30 p.m. tonight, the Vietnam women's volleyball team took a flight from Thailand to Noi Bai airport, Hanoi. Representatives of the Vietnam Volleyball Federation, reporters and some audiences welcomed the team in the hall.
Accordingly, coach Nguyen Tuan Kiet and his team will continue to travel to Ninh Binh to prepare for the next round of the SEA V.League.

Phase 2 of the 2025 SEA V.League will be held at the Ninh Binh Provincial Gymnasium from August 8 to August 10. In addition to host Vietnam, the teams of Thailand, Indonesia, and the Philippines have a travel schedule to Ninh Binh to continue competing.
The local organizing committee in Ninh Binh informed Lao Dong that currently, preparations are ready, the field meets the professional requirements of Asian standards to serve the competing teams.
Bich Tuyen's former teammates did not participate in the second stage of the SEA V.League
Today, the Thai Volleyball Federation has finalized the list of squads participating in the second phase of the 2025 SEA V.League. Accordingly, young striker Warisara will not participate in the match held in Ninh Binh.
The reason is that this female athlete will join the Thai U21 team to participate in the U21 World Championship - a tournament that U21 Vietnam will also participate in in in the next few days.
Warisara is no stranger to Vietnamese volleyball fans. Last season, she wore the LPB Ninh Binh shirt to compete in the 2024 national championship. The Thai female striker is quite close to Bich Tuyen and created a harmonious duo on the field.
